Abstract: (CDS)
We present results on the commissioning of CMS electron reconstruction and identification using the first LHC collisions at \surd s = 7 TeV recorded by the CMS detector, corresponding to an integrated luminosity of \sim 200 nb1{}^{-1}. The electron and photon Level 1 and High Level Trigger efficiencies have been measured from data. The main observables for CMS electron reconstruction, identification, isolation and conversion rejection have been measured and compared to Monte Carlo simulation. The performance of the electron reconstruction and identification has been studied on data. Different selections proposed to be used in physics studies with electrons are studied and compared to the Monte Carlo expectations.
